Here’s a guide on how to effectively vinyl wrap your kitchen cabinets.Understanding Vinyl WrappingVinyl wrapping involves applying a high-quality vinyl film over your existing cabinet surfaces. This method is particularly popular for its versatility and ease of application. Homeowners choose vinyl wrapping for several reasons:Cost-Effective: It is less expensive than replacing cabinets.Variety of Designs: Available in numerous colors, textures, and finishes.Quick Installation: Can often be done in a weekend.Easy Maintenance: Vinyl surfaces are generally easy to clean.Preparing Your Cabinets for WrappingBefore you start wrapping, proper preparation is crucial for a smooth application. Follow these steps:Clean the Surfaces: Use a mild cleaner to remove grease and grime.Remove Hardware: Take off handles and knobs to ensure a seamless finish.Repair Damages: Fill in any dents or scratches with wood filler.Choosing the Right VinylWhen selecting vinyl for wrapping, consider durability and design. Look for:Quality Vinyl: Opt for high-grade vinyl that can withstand wear and tear.Design Options: Choose a style that complements your kitchen’s aesthetic.Application ProcessOnce you have everything ready, it’s time to apply the vinyl. Here’s a step-by-step guide:Measure and Cut: Measure each cabinet door and cut vinyl accordingly.Apply Heat: Use a heat gun to make the vinyl more pliable.Stick and Smooth: Carefully apply the vinyl, smoothing out air bubbles as you go.Trim Excess: Use a sharp utility knife to trim any excess vinyl at the edges.Maintaining Wrapped CabinetsTo ensure longevity, follow these maintenance tips:Avoid harsh chemicals that can damage the vinyl.Regularly clean with a soft cloth and mild soap.Be gentle when cleaning to avoid peeling edges.Benefits of Vinyl WrappingVinyl wrapping kitchen cabinets not only enhances aesthetic appeal but also offers several functional benefits:Eco-Friendly: A sustainable alternative to replacing cabinetry.Customization: Personalize your kitchen space with unique designs.Resale Value: An updated kitchen can increase your home’s value.ConclusionVinyl wrapping kitchen cabinets is a fantastic way to modernize your space without breaking the bank.
